  • Location

    London, United Kingdom

  • Duration

    1 year

  • Start Date

    October 2024

  • Application Deadline

    Open application

  • Language

    English

  • Study Type

    On campus

  • Pace

    Full-time 12 months

  • Tuition Fees

    UK/EU: £8,500
    Internationals: £12,000

Entry requirements

At King Stage, we seek individuals with intellectual curiosity and a strong desire to contribute. To ensure your success with us, here are the following entry criteria we look at:
You will be required to provide an internationally recognised qualification: a Bachelor’s degree or equivalent.
If you are a mature applicant, you will be considered for entry if you can demonstrate a minimum of 2 years of relevant work experience, and have A Levels/IB or equivalent.
Non-native speakers must provide proof of their proficiency in English. We require an IETLS score of at least 6.0/B2 equivalent in TOEFL. Alternatively, we can provide you with an English Language Level Test to confirm your level.
